How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Compton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Compton Studio Apartments | $1,460 | $1,377 | $1,505 |
| Compton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,859 | $591 | $3,206 |
| Compton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,217 | $732 | $3,999 |
| Compton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,466 | $1,400 | $4,245 |
| Compton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,399 | $2,399 | $2,399 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Compton
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Compton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Compton ranges from $591 to $3,206 with an average monthly rent of $1,859.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Compton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Compton range from $732 to $3,999.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,217.
How expensive are Compton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 23 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Compton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,400 to $4,245 - averaging $2,466 for the location.
